mysql mac my.cnf位置

mysql mac my.cnf位置

mysql mac my.cnf位置

在Mac操作系统上,MySQL的配置文件通常被存储在 /etc 目录下,其文件名为 my.cnf。MySQL配置文件包含了数据库的各种设置,比如端口号、日志文件等。

查找my.cnf文件位置

要查找MySQL配置文件 my.cnf 的位置,可以通过终端来进行操作。首先打开终端程序,然后输入以下命令:

$ sudo find / -name my.cnf

这条命令会在整个系统中寻找名为 my.cnf 的文件,并显示其路径。一般来说,MySQL的配置文件存储在 /etc/my.cnf 或者 /etc/mysql/my.cnf 目录下。

另外,如果 MySQL 的版本为 5.7 以上,还有可能在用户根目录下的 .my.cnf 文件中配置 MySQL 的一些参数。

编辑my.cnf文件

要编辑 MySQL 的配置文件 my.cnf,可以使用任何文本编辑器。在终端中输入以下命令打开 my.cnf 文件:

$ sudo vi /etc/my.cnf

然后就可以在 vi 编辑器中进行相应的修改。

重启MySQL服务生效设置

在修改完 MySQL 的配置文件后,需要重启 MySQL 服务才能使设置生效。可以通过以下命令来重启 MySQL 服务:

$ sudo systemctl restart mysql

这样就完成了 MySQL 配置文件的编辑和生效的整个过程。

示例

假设我们要修改 MySQL 的默认端口号,我们可以通过编辑 my.cnf 文件来实现。

首先使用 vi 编辑器打开 my.cnf 文件:

$ sudo vi /etc/my.cnf

找到 port 参数并将其修改为想要的端口号,比如 3307。然后保存并退出 vi 编辑器。

接着重启 MySQL 服务:

$ sudo systemctl restart mysql

这样就成功修改了 MySQL 的端口设置。你可以通过以下命令查看当前 MySQL 的端口号是否已经生效:

$ sudo netstat -tuln | grep mysql

运行结果应该包含新的端口号 3307。这说明我们已经成功修改了 MySQL 的端口号设置。

总的来说,MySQL 的配置文件 my.cnf 在Mac系统上通常存储在 /etc 目录下,通过编辑该文件并重启 MySQL 服务可以实现对数据库各种设置的修改。

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程